1. Performance and Specifications

The performance of an all-in-one computer primarily depends on its specifications, particularly the processor, RAM, and storage options. While the Intel Core i3 processor is a solid performer suitable for daily tasks such as web browsing, document editing, and streaming media, it’s essential to consider the specific generation of the i3 chip. Newer generations typically provide better performance and energy efficiency. Opt for at least an 8th generation or later i3 for a smoother experience, especially if you plan to multitask.

In addition to the processor, RAM and storage configurations play significant roles in overall performance. Aim for a minimum of 8 GB of RAM, as this will enable your computer to run multiple applications simultaneously without significant lag. Regarding storage, consider an SSD over an HDD for faster boot times and quicker access to files. If you anticipate storing large amounts of data or files, look for hybrid options that combine SSD and HDD components.

2. Display Quality

The display quality of an all-in-one computer is another critical factor, as it affects your visual experience for tasks ranging from work to entertainment. Look for a minimum resolution of Full HD (1920 x 1080) for crisp and clear imagery. Higher resolutions, such as 4K, would be ideal for graphic design or video editing, but may not be necessary for everyday use.

Moreover, consider the display type and features, such as anti-glare coatings, color accuracy, and viewing angles. An IPS display will provide better color reproduction and wider viewing angles compared to a TN panel. Touchscreen functionality can also enhance usability, especially for interactions like drawing or navigating through applications, making it a desirable feature for many users.

4. Connectivity Options

Connectivity options are vital when it comes to the best Intel Core i3 all-in-one computers because they determine how easily you can connect to other devices and networks. Look for a variety of USB ports, including USB-C, which allows for faster data transfer and can charge devices. HDMI and DisplayPort outputs are useful if you want to connect to additional monitors or projectors.

Wi-Fi and Bluetooth capabilities are also essential in today’s increasingly wireless world. Ensure the computer supports the latest Wi-Fi standards, such as Wi-Fi 6, which offers improved speed and reliability. Bluetooth support allows for the connection of peripherals like keyboards, mice, and speakers without cluttering your workspace with cables.

Can I upgrade the components of an Intel Core i3 All-In-One computer?

Most Intel Core i3 All-In-One computers are not designed for easy upgrades due to their compact and integrated nature. Many models have components like RAM and storage that can be upgraded, but accessing these parts may require a bit of technical know-how. It is essential to consult the manufacturer’s documentation to determine which components are user-replaceable before purchasing. Some models may allow for access through service panels, while others may need to be completely disassembled.

That said, as technology advances, you may find some newer models with modular designs that offer greater flexibility for updates. If upgrading components is a priority for you, it’s advisable to research specific models that provide this capability. Alternatively, choosing a computer that meets your current demands will be the best option, since All-In-One devices are often designed for a balance between performance and functionality rather than a focus on upgradeability.

Are Intel Core i3 All-In-One computers suitable for gaming?

Intel Core i3 All-In-One computers can handle casual gaming, but their effectiveness for gaming situations heavily depends on the specific model and its GPU capabilities. Most All-In-One computers utilize integrated graphics, which may not provide the necessary performance for modern, graphics-intensive games. If gaming is a significant aspect of your use case, it may be wise to consider models that offer dedicated GPUs or enhanced graphics capabilities, as these will provide a better gaming experience.

However, if your gaming preferences revolve around less demanding, older titles or casual games, an Intel Core i3 setup may suffice. Always consider factors such as RAM and processor speed in tandem with the graphics capabilities when evaluating performance for gaming. Researching user reviews and benchmarks for specific models can also yield insights into how well a computer performs with various games.
